Boyd Rice / NON
Boyd Rice is an American experimental sound artist, archivist, actor, photographer, writer, and provocateur, best known for his work under the name NON. Emerging from the early industrial and avant-garde experimental music scenes, he is associated with the development of industrial noise music from the 1970s onward. Beyond music, his work spans photography, writing, and cultural commentary, including explorations of subcultural and cult film material. His multidisciplinary practice and provocative public persona have made him a notable figure within American underground art circles. Alternately amusing, insightful, confrontational and offensive, Boyd has proven one of the most consistently influential and contentious characters of the last 50 years of American counterculture.
